Oil Prices rise as tensions escalation in the Middle East
SANA NEWS -

New York, SANA-Oil prices climbed as tensions in the Middle East intensified, with continued exchanges of fire between Israel and Iran keeping markets on edge.

According to CNN Business, Brent crude futures rose by $1.17, or 1.6%, reaching $74.40 per barrel, while U.S. West Texas Intermediate (WTI) crude increased by $1.34, or 1.87%, to $73.11 per barrel.
